Choosing the right foldable solar panel with USB output involves several key considerations beyond just wattage. Understanding these factors ensures you pick a device that meets your specific mobility, power, and durability needs without overpaying for unnecessary features or sacrificing reliability.Power Output and Charging Speed
Wattage determines how quickly your devices can be charged, especially when using USB-C PD (Power Delivery). A higher wattage panel, such as 60W or more, can charge tablets, smartphones, and even small laptops faster, saving you time in the field. However, larger panels tend to be bulkier, sometimes reducing portability. For casual camping or emergency prep, a lower wattage panel (around 20-30W) may suffice, but for frequent use with multiple devices, investing in higher capacity models pays off.
USB Ports and Compatibility
The number and types of USB ports impact how many devices you can charge simultaneously and whether you can power newer devices with fast-charging USB-C. Models with USB-C Power Delivery support can charge compatible phones and tablets significantly faster. Some panels offer dual USB-C ports, ideal for multi-device households or groups. Be cautious: not all USB ports support fast charging, so verify specifications if speed is important for your devices.
Waterproofing and Durability
Outdoor environments demand panels that can withstand weather, splashes, or dust. Waterproof ratings like IP65, IP67, or IPX5 indicate different levels of protection—higher ratings generally mean better durability. Folding panels with rugged exteriors and reinforced frames tend to last longer in rough conditions. Consider your typical use: a waterproof, dustproof model is essential for wilderness adventures, while less protected panels might suffice for occasional use.
Size, Weight, and Portability
Balancing size and weight is critical for portable solar panels. Larger panels with higher wattage often add bulk, making them less convenient to carry. Lightweight panels, sometimes under a pound, are excellent for backpackers but may have lower power output. Foldable designs help manage size, but pay attention to how compact the panel becomes when folded, especially if space is limited in your gear setup.
Price and Value
Price varies widely based on wattage, durability, and features like fast-charging USB-C ports. While cheaper models may seem attractive, they often lack ruggedness or fast charging capabilities, limiting usability. Conversely, premium panels tend to offer better build quality and higher power but come at a premium. Consider your typical use case and budget—sometimes paying more upfront yields a longer-lasting, more reliable product, which is especially important for emergency or frequent outdoor use.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I charge multiple devices at once with a foldable solar panel?
Yes, many foldable solar panels come with multiple USB ports, allowing you to charge several devices simultaneously. When selecting a panel, check the total wattage and port specifications to ensure it can deliver enough power for multiple gadgets, especially if you’re charging power-hungry devices like tablets or cameras. Keep in mind that the total charging speed may be divided among connected devices, so high-capacity panels with multiple fast-charging ports are preferable for multi-device use.
Will a foldable solar panel work efficiently on cloudy days?
While solar panels perform best in direct sunlight, many models still generate some power on cloudy days, albeit at reduced efficiency. The output depends on the panel’s quality and wattage; higher-quality panels with high conversion rates tend to perform better in less-than-ideal conditions. If you expect frequent overcast weather, consider a panel with higher wattage or a backup power source to ensure your devices stay charged.
How durable are foldable solar panels for outdoor use?
Durability varies significantly among models. Panels rated IP67 or IP65 are designed to resist water and dust, making them suitable for rugged outdoor conditions. The quality of materials like reinforced frames and weather-resistant fabrics also impacts longevity. It’s advisable to choose a panel with a sturdy construction if you plan to use it regularly outdoors or in challenging environments.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ning the surface, can also extend the lifespan of your panel.
Can I use a foldable solar panel to charge my laptop?
Charging laptops requires higher power levels typically supported by panels with at least 60W or more, often via USB-C PD ports. Not all foldable panels can deliver such power, so verify the wattage and port specifications before attempting to charge a laptop. Using a suitable USB-C PD charger or power station in combination with the panel can improve compatibility and charging speeds, especially for larger devices. Keep in mind that cloudy weather or low sunlight will slow down charging significantly.
Are foldable solar panels suitable for emergency backup power?
Absolutely, foldable solar panels are a practical addition to emergency kits, providing renewable power in off-grid scenarios. For reliable backup, choose a panel with sufficient wattage and waterproof ratings, and consider pairing it with a portable power bank or battery pack. This setup allows stored energy to be used when sunlight isn’t available, ensuring your essential devices stay operational during outages or outdoor emergencies. Investing in a higher-capacity panel offers longer-lasting power during critical moments.
